How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Opa-Locka?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Opa-Locka Studio Apartments | $1,575 | $1,500 | $1,650 |
Opa-Locka 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,847 | $1,195 | $2,390 |
Opa-Locka 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,284 | $1,418 | $3,090 |
Opa-Locka 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,951 | $1,625 | $3,400 |
Opa-Locka 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,795 | $1,795 | $1,795 |
